The Pegasus Autocode
B. Clarke and
G. E. Felton
Ferranti Ltd, London, UK
A simplified method of preparing certain programs for the Ferranti Pegasus Computer is described from the point of view of the user, who need have no knowledge of ordinary programming. The programming techniques used to make the computer accept this kind of program are also discussed, together with the reasons for choosing them.
